    Lady Trojans Sweep Democracy Prep Knights in Home Victory

    By Amy VelozOctober 9, 2025No Comments3 Mins Read
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Email Copy Link
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Email Copy Link

    The Pahrump Valley High School Lady Trojans volleyball team dominated on the road against the Democracy Prep Knights, sweeping the match in three straight sets through disciplined serving, strong net play, and sharp communication across all rotations.

    The first set opened with a commanding serving streak from Henna Maiava, who fired off four consecutive aces before a serve into the net broke her rhythm. The Trojans maintained their lead behind Heavenly Ware’s powerful spikes and Riley Saldaña’s deep shots to the back court. Nala Dalton rotated in to serve, helping to keep momentum steady while Miani Freitas-Faamai and Marayah Waller worked the front line to challenge the Knights’ defense. Despite a few miscues, the Trojans’ energy never wavered—Maiava added two more aces late in the set, followed by a perfectly timed spike from Ware. A final block attempt from Democracy Prep fell short, giving Pahrump the 25–8 win.

    In the second set, the Trojans’ teamwork and confidence continued to shine. Myah Krolczyk opened the scoring before Sedona Norton stepped up to the service line, delivering an ace that stretched the lead. Miani Freitas-Faamai kept the offense rolling with a quick tip over the net, and when the Knights tried to rally, Ware answered with another strong spike off a clean dig from the back row. Amaliah Mendoza added back-to-back aces during her service rotation, keeping the Knights on their heels. The Trojans’ front line stayed alert, with Waller saving a ball that nearly dropped on Pahrump’s side and turning it into a point. Dalton followed with three consecutive aces as the Knights struggled to return serves. Krolczyk later added an ace of her own, and Maiava capped the set with another hard serve that dropped untouched for a 25–12 finish.

    The third set featured more balanced back-and-forth play as Democracy Prep adjusted, but Pahrump quickly regained control. Maiava started things off again with an ace, while Saldaña powered a spike across court to put the Trojans back on top. Ware’s serving run extended the lead before Xe’ane Kamanu entered the action with a key block at the net to stop a Knights attack. Norton once again came through with consecutive aces to tie the score mid-set, and Madison Rodriguez anchored the back row with steady passing. Mendoza’s ace and Waller’s quick tip helped Pahrump edge ahead 9–8.

    As the game intensified, the Trojans’ teamwork shone—Kamanu blocked a tight net play, and Ware added another kill off a clean set from Maiava. Dalton delivered an ace to widen the gap before Kamanu scored back-to-back aces of her own, including one that just rolled over the top of the net. Mendoza sealed the match with two final aces, closing out the set 25–18.

    Every player on the Lady Trojans’ roster—Henna Maiava, Xe’ane Kamanu, Heavenly Ware, Riley Saldaña, Nala Dalton, Miani Freitas-Faamai, Amaliah Mendoza, Myah Krolczyk, Marayah Waller, Sedona Norton, and Madison Rodriguez—contributed to the sweep with consistent energy and communication. The team’s serving accuracy and defensive hustle kept the Knights off balance all night, marking another strong performance for the Lady Trojans as they continue their season.
